Embark on your thrilling adventure in Japan by exploring the bustling city of Tokyo. In the morning, start your day with a visit to the iconic Tsukiji Fish Market, where you can witness the lively auction of fresh seafood. Afterward, head to Odaiba, a futuristic district offering exciting attractions such as the teamLab Borderless digital art museum and the Gundam Statue.
In the evening, venture to the quirky neighborhood of Harajuku and explore Takeshita Street, known for its vibrant fashion scene and unique shops. Don't miss out on trying some mouthwatering crepes from the street vendors.
Escape the city and immerse yourself in the natural beauty of Hakone. Start your morning with a visit to Lake Ashi, where you can take a boat cruise and admire the stunning views of Mount Fuji. Continue your adventure by exploring the Owakudani Valley, famous for its volcanic activity and unique black eggs boiled in hot springs.
In the afternoon, experience the thrill of the Hakone Ropeway, a cable car ride that offers panoramic views of the surrounding mountains and valleys. End your day by relaxing in a traditional onsen (hot spring) and rejuvenating your body and mind.
Continue your adventure in Japan by visiting the historic city of Kyoto. Begin your day by exploring the enchanting Arashiyama Bamboo Grove, a serene forest of towering bamboo stalks. Take a peaceful stroll through the grove, capturing memorable photos along the way.
In the afternoon, visit Kinkaku-ji, the famous Golden Pavilion, known for its stunning architecture and picturesque surroundings. Explore the beautiful Zen garden and learn about the history of this UNESCO World Heritage site.
End your day by wandering through the traditional streets of Gion, Kyoto's historic geisha district. Experience the charm of this preserved neighborhood and keep an eye out for geisha or maiko (apprentice geisha) walking along the streets.
For adventurous travelers seeking off the beaten path experiences in Japan, consider visiting the Takeda Castle Ruins in Hyogo Prefecture. Often referred to as "Japan's Machu Picchu," this stunning castle was built on a mountain peak and offers breathtaking views, especially during sunrise or sunset. Another hidden gem is the Shikoku Island pilgrimage, where you can embark on a spiritual journey by visiting 88 temples scattered across the island. This pilgrimage is perfect for those seeking a unique adventure and a deeper understanding of Japanese culture and religion.
